Tuition Fees and Cost of Living in North Cyprus (2025–2026)

One of the strongest reasons to study in North Cyprus for international students is the balance between quality and affordability.

  • Average annual tuition: €2,200 to €6,500 depending on faculty.

  • Medicine & Dentistry: €5,800 to €12,500 per year.

  • Pharmacy, Nursing, and Physiotherapy: usually €3,000 to €6,000 per year.

  • Master’s degrees (MBA, Engineering, IT): €2,500 to €6,000 total program.

Living cost in North Cyprus is also reasonable:

  • Accommodation: €150 to €300/month in dorms or €250 – €400/month in shared apartments.

  • Food & daily expenses: €150 to €250/month.

  • Transportation: €20 to €40/month with student card.

Total monthly expenses usually stay around €300–€500, making North Cyprus one of the cheapest places to study abroad in Europe.

1. Near East University (NEU) - Study Medicine and Engineering in a Top-Tier Private Institution

Near East University is the largest and most established university in North Cyprus, enrolling over 26,000 students from more than 100 countries. It is internationally respected for its comprehensive academic offerings, particularly in medicine, engineering, information technology, architecture, and pharmacy. With modern infrastructure, including a fully operational teaching hospital, NEU provides students with real-world, hands-on training. Its medical and health sciences programs, taught entirely in English, are especially sought after by international students aiming to pursue clinical careers in Europe at a fraction of the cost compared to other destinations.

2. Cyprus International University (CIU)- Modern Campus with Global Reach

The international reputation of CIU, which has its roots in Nicosia itself, is notable due to the presence of large student body from Africa, Middle East and Asia. English is the language of choice for undergraduate and postgraduate studies in business administration, psychology, computer science (both master's and PhD degrees), as well as engineering courses. With well-structured internship programs, career counseling, and a focus on research-based learning every year, the university is truly committed to its students. The school's thriving green campus, contemporary labs, and student clubs for international students make it a multi-cultural institution.

3. Girne American University (GAU) – American-Style Education with Global Mobility

Established in 1985, GAU is the first American-curriculum private university in Cyprus, offering students global academic pathways through partnerships in the United States, United Kingdom, Moldova, and Turkey. GAU’s English-medium instruction and dual-degree options allow students to study across multiple campuses. Programs in aviation, international business, communication, marine studies, and tourism management are especially prominent. The university emphasizes innovation, entrepreneurship, and cross-border learning, making it an excellent choice for internationally minded students.

4. Eastern Mediterranean University (EMU) – QS-Ranked University with Research Excellence

A public university in Famagusto, Eastern Mediterranean University is known for its academic excellence, multiculturalism and engineering programs. EMU, which has students from over 110 countries and more than 18,000 students, is a top-ranked university in the Mediterranean area. UNESCO, the Turkish Council of Higher Education (YK), and other international accreditation bodies grant official recognition to programs that are ranked in the QS. Furthermore... Those seeking internationally respected degrees are more likely to choose EMU as their preferred choice because of its emphasis on employability and research.

5. Final International University (FIU) – New Institution with Industry-Focused Programs

FIU, supported by the Final Education Group, is a growing university dedicated to providing high-quality, market-aligned education. It offers programs in education, law, and health sciences, with an emphasis on bilingual instruction and practical skill development. The university is gaining popularity among students from Central Asia, the Middle East, and Africa who seek accessible, career-driven academic programs in an international setting.

6. University of Kyrenia – Specialized Training in Maritime and Aviation Fields

Affiliated with Near East University, the University of Kyrenia stands out for its focus on nautical sciences, aviation, and health-related programs. The institution offers specialized degrees supported by advanced simulators, laboratories, and training vessels, making it a strategic choice for students aiming for careers in the maritime or aviation industries. The campus is situated along the Mediterranean coast, providing an appealing environment for both study and leisure.

Global Recognition and Accreditations of North Cyprus Universities

North Cyprus has established itself as a reputable destination for international education, attracting students from over 100 countries. A key driver of this reputation is the strong global accreditation status of its universities, ensuring that degrees awarded are recognized and valued worldwide.

Most universities in North Cyprus both public and private are accredited by YÖK (The Council of Higher Education in Turkey). This national accreditation ensures academic parity with Turkish universities, enabling graduates to transfer degrees or pursue further studies in Turkey and many other countries.

For medical and health science programs, several institutions hold listings in the World Directory of Medical Schools and are recognized by the World Health Organization (WHO) and the Educational Commission for Foreign Medical Graduates (ECFMG). These credentials qualify graduates to sit for USMLE exams and pursue clinical practice or postgraduate studies in the United States and internationally.

In the field of engineering, programs are accredited by ABET (Accreditation Board for Engineering and Technology), meeting global industry and academic benchmarks. Likewise, business and economics programs are recognized by FIBAA, affirming the international competitiveness of their curricula.

Academic networks such as the European University Association (EUA), UNIMED, and IAU include leading universities like Near East Universities or the Eastern Mediterranean Universities. All of these institutions are full members. These associations strengthen the credibility of our institution and allow graduates to move around the world.

Public vs. Private Universities in North Cyprus: Which Is Better for International Students?

When considering higher education in North Cyprus, international students often compare public and private universities to find the most suitable option. While North Cyprus doesn’t impose the strict public university restrictions found in other countries, understanding the differences can help prospective students make informed decisions. Here’s a detailed breakdown to guide international applicants.

Admission Requirements: Private Universities Offer Easier Access

One of the major distinctions between public and private universities in North Cyprus is the admission process. Public universities typically have limited seats and competitive entry requirements, especially for high-demand programs like Medicine, Dentistry, and Engineering. These institutions may require entrance exams, interviews, or minimum GPA thresholds, making entry more selective.

In contrast, private universities such as Near East University (NEU), Cyprus International University (CIU), and Girne American University (GAU) provide easy and guaranteed admission for international students. Most programs do not require standardized exams or language proficiency certificates (like IELTS or TOEFL), especially if the applicant chooses to enroll in a foundation year or English prep school.

Application Deadlines: Rolling Admissions at Private Universities

Public universities in North Cyprus usually follow early and fixed deadlines, making it harder for late applicants to enroll. On the other hand, private institutions operate with rolling admissions, allowing students to apply and get accepted throughout the year. This flexibility is especially beneficial for students applying last-minute or transferring from another institution.

Tuition Fees: Affordable with Scholarships

Although public universities may have slightly lower tuition fees, they often lack financial aid options for non-EU or non-Turkish students. In contrast, private universities offer moderate tuition fees (e.g., €2,500–€6,000 per year for most programs) and generous partial scholarships, making them more accessible financially.

Student Support: Private Universities Provide Better Services

Private universities are known for offering extensive international student services, including airport pickup, visa guidance, accommodation assistance, and on-campus support offices. Public universities tend to provide only moderate support, which may not be sufficient for first-time international students navigating a new environment.
